How Does CareLuminate Estimate The Nurse Recommendation Score?
With over 1,000 nurses having participated with CareLuminate to date, we have found that the relationship between hospital patient recommendation ratings and nurse recommendation ratings is very strong (p<.001, R-squared = .42).
While the two ratings are often similar, the comments from nurses are extremely important because they show an important 'inside view' into strengths or concerns in a hospital. CareLuminate is working towards offering nurse insights into every hospital in the US.

Summary of Hospital-Reported Data
The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services requires hospitals to collect and report on hospital quality and patient satisfaction data. While the data can be dated (collected 1 to 4 years ago) the insights are an important view into hospital safety and quality. We looked through all of this data, and here is our summary of what we found:
Bay Park Community Hospital receives high overall patient satisfaction and demonstrates average mortality rates across all measured categories. The hospital's emergency department has an average wait time of 2-3 hours, indicating patients are seen and treated within a reasonable timeframe. However, it is important to note that the hospital faces challenges with high infection rates, suggesting a need for improvement in this area.
